Why BigBear.ai Stock Is Skyrocketing Today

BigBear.ai stock has surged 66% year to date, driven by recent strong quarterly results and acquisition news. On Wednesday, the stock gained 13.4% by noon ET, peaking at a 22.4% increase earlier in the trading session.

Quarterly Report Outperforms Expectations

After Monday's market close, BigBear.ai released its third-quarter earnings, reporting sales of $33.14 million, which exceeded the average analyst estimate by $1.3 million despite a 20% year-over-year revenue decline. The company’s loss per share was $0.03, beating expectations by $0.04.

Strategic Acquisition to Boost Growth

BigBear.ai also announced the acquisition of Ask Sage for $250 million. Investors and analysts believe this deal will enhance BigBear.ai's position in generative artificial intelligence (AI) and help secure more government contracts.

Investor Sentiment and Market Trends

The stock’s valuation has climbed significantly this year as investors pay premium multiples for companies exposed to defense AI trends. However, BigBear.ai’s core business performance has declined notably in 2025.
